資料介紹
PLC 以 其 可靠性高、抗干擾能力強、配套齊全、功能完善、適應(yīng)性強等特點,廣泛應(yīng)用于各種控制領(lǐng)域。PLC作為通用工業(yè)控制計算機,是面向工礦企業(yè)的工控設(shè)備,使用梯形圖符號進行編程,與繼電器電路相當(dāng)接近,被廣大工程技術(shù)人員接受。但是在實際應(yīng)用中,如何編程能夠提高PLC程序運行速度是一個值得我們思考研究的問題。
1 PLC工作原理
PLC 與 計 算機的工作原理基本相同,即在系統(tǒng)程序的管理下,通過運行應(yīng)用程序完成用戶任務(wù)。但兩者的工作方式有所不同。計算機一般采用等待命令的工作方式,而PLC在確定了工作任務(wù)并裝人了專用程序后成為一種專用機,它采用循環(huán)掃描工作方式,系統(tǒng)工作任務(wù)管理及應(yīng)用程序執(zhí)行都是用循環(huán)掃描方式完成的。PLC 有 兩 種基本的工作狀態(tài),即運行(RUN)與停止(STOP)狀態(tài)。在這兩種狀態(tài)下,PLC的掃描過程及所要完成的任務(wù)是不盡相同的,如圖1所示。
PLC在RUN工作狀態(tài)時,執(zhí)行一次掃描操作所的時間稱為掃描周期,其典型值通常為1一100nis,不同PLC廠家的產(chǎn)品則略有不同。掃描周期由內(nèi)部處理時間、輸A/ 輸出處理執(zhí)行時間、指令執(zhí)行時間等三部分組成。通常在一個掃描過程中,執(zhí)行指令的時間占了絕大部分,而執(zhí)行指令的時間與用戶程序的長短有關(guān)。用戶 程 序 是根據(jù)控制要求由用戶編制,由許多條PLC指令所組成。不同的指令所對應(yīng)的程序步不同,以三菱FX2N系列的PLC為例,PLC對每一個程序步操作處理時間為:基本指令占0.741s/步,功能指令占幾百微米/步。完成一個控制任務(wù)可以有多種編制程序的方法,因此,選擇合理、巧妙的編程方法既可以大大提高程序運行速度,又可以保證可靠性。
提高PLC程序運行速度的幾種編程方法2.1 用數(shù)據(jù)傳送給位元件組合的方法來控制輸出在 PL C應(yīng) 用編程中,最后都會有一段輸出控制程序,一般都是用邏輯取及輸出指令來編寫,如圖2所示。在圖2所示的程序中,邏輯取的程序步為1,輸出的程序步為2,執(zhí)行上述程序共需3個程序步。通常情況下,PLC要控制的輸出都不會是少量的,比如,有8個輸出,在條件滿足時要同時輸出。此時,執(zhí)行圖2所示的程序共需17個程序步。若我們通過位元件的組合并采用數(shù)據(jù)傳送的方法來完成圖2所示的程序,就會大大減少程序步驟。在三 菱 PLC中,只處理ON/OFF狀態(tài)的元件(如X,Y,M和S),稱為位元件。但將位元件組合起來也可以處理數(shù)據(jù)。位元件組合由Kn加首元件號來表示。位元件每4bit為一組組合成單元。如KYO中的n是組數(shù),當(dāng)n=1時,K,Yo 對應(yīng)的是Y3一Yo。當(dāng)n二2時,KZYo對應(yīng)的是Y7一Yo。通過位元件組合,就可以用處理數(shù)據(jù)的方式來處理位元件,圖2程序所示的功能可用圖3所示的傳送數(shù)據(jù)的方式來完成。
- 西門子PLC的幾種編程語言簡單介紹
 - 華大HC32F460 HC32F4A0加速程序運行速度
 - 臺達(dá)PLC編程解密軟件安裝程序下載 17次下載
 - 信捷PLC編程軟件XDPPro_3.5.1下載 20次下載
 - 松下PLC編程軟件FPWINGR操作教程下載 64次下載
 - 西門子S7-400H-PLC的幾種故障分析及處理方法 9次下載
 - 如何讓ARM代碼執(zhí)行速度更快?資料下載
 - PLC編程用戶手冊之CoDeSys 2.3電子書 26次下載
 - 如何使用STL編程實現(xiàn)PLC控制系統(tǒng)的模擬量信號和采樣與濾波 63次下載
 - 編寫PLC程序的步驟是怎么樣的 22次下載
 - 如何在IAR環(huán)境下將程序拷貝在RAM中運行 11次下載
 - 如何優(yōu)化C語言的編程運行速度資料免費下載
 - 如何自己制作PLC編程電纜 44次下載
 - 海為PLC在油田注水監(jiān)控系統(tǒng)上的應(yīng)用 11次下載
 - C程序運行環(huán)境和運行C程序的方法
 
- 三菱plc程序后綴名有幾種 3312次閱讀
 - plc編程入門基礎(chǔ)知識 plc編程語言有幾種 1740次閱讀
 - plc編程怎么樣?關(guān)于PLC編程的幾條建議 1647次閱讀
 - PLC編程案例:設(shè)備的運行累計時間怎么設(shè)計? 2751次閱讀
 - PLC編程優(yōu)化設(shè)計使程序運行提速 1261次閱讀
 - PLC梯形圖程序的基本規(guī)則和基本編程方法 1w次閱讀
 - 固態(tài)硬盤會不會影響整個電腦的運行速度 2.1w次閱讀
 - 如何提高PLC編程能力 7296次閱讀
 - PLC編程中如何連接電腦將程序寫入PLC 1.8w次閱讀
 - 技術(shù) | 如何提高 VMware 虛擬機下服務(wù)系統(tǒng)運行性能? 3674次閱讀
 - 如何提高PLC程序運行的效率詳細(xì)編程方法說明 3386次閱讀
 - 提高PLC運行速度的編程方法 4833次閱讀
 - 對PLC程序運行效率得到提高的方法的解析 3963次閱讀
 - 通過減少程序語句數(shù)來提高PLC程序運行效率 4665次閱讀
 - 詳解繼電器與PLC控制間的聯(lián)鎖技術(shù) 5559次閱讀
 
下載排行
本周
- 1DH1766系列·三路可編程直流電源技術(shù)手冊
 - 1.93 MB | 3次下載 | 免費
 - 2智能蓄電池充放電測試儀 蓄電池放電檢測儀專業(yè)防護功能
 - 0.13 MB | 2次下載 | 免費
 - 3GD選型手冊
 - 6.92 MB | 2次下載 | 免費
 - 4FP136 高端電流檢測IC芯片說明書
 - 0.62 MB | 1次下載 | 免費
 - 533A66-B1 rk3399開發(fā)板規(guī)格書
 - 1.15 MB | 1次下載 | 1 積分
 - 6FP137 高端電流檢測IC芯片說明書
 - 0.68 MB | 1次下載 | 免費
 - 7HAL9303線性霍爾效應(yīng)傳感器技術(shù)手冊
 - 0.70 MB | 1次下載 | 免費
 - 8HC88L051F4低功耗芯片規(guī)格書
 - 4.76 MB | 1次下載 | 免費
 
本月
- 1常用電子元器件使用手冊
 - 2.40 MB | 34次下載 | 免費
 - 2高功率密度碳化硅MOSFET軟開關(guān)三相逆變器損耗分析
 - 2.27 MB | 33次下載 | 10 積分
 - 3MS1826 HDMI 多功能視頻處理器數(shù)據(jù)手冊
 - 4.51 MB | 8次下載 | 免費
 - 4USB拓展塢PCB圖資料
 - 0.57 MB | 8次下載 | 免費
 - 5經(jīng)典1000W純正弦波逆變器原理圖資料
 - 0.08 MB | 8次下載 | 10 積分
 - 6TYPEC電路原理圖資料
 - 0.14 MB | 7次下載 | 免費
 - 7SR520-SR5100肖特基二極管規(guī)格書
 - 0.11 MB | 4次下載 | 免費
 - 8DH1766系列·三路可編程直流電源技術(shù)手冊
 - 1.93 MB | 3次下載 | 免費
 
總榜
- 1matlab軟件下載入口
 - 未知 | 935134次下載 | 10 積分
 - 2開源硬件-PMP21529.1-4 開關(guān)降壓/升壓雙向直流/直流轉(zhuǎn)換器 PCB layout 設(shè)計
 - 1.48MB | 420064次下載 | 10 積分
 - 3Altium DXP2002下載入口
 - 未知 | 233089次下載 | 10 積分
 - 4電路仿真軟件multisim 10.0免費下載
 - 340992 | 191424次下載 | 10 積分
 - 5十天學(xué)會AVR單片機與C語言視頻教程 下載
 - 158M | 183352次下載 | 10 積分
 - 6labview8.5下載
 - 未知 | 81600次下載 | 10 積分
 - 7Keil工具MDK-Arm免費下載
 - 0.02 MB | 73818次下載 | 10 積分
 - 8LabVIEW 8.6下載
 - 未知 | 65991次下載 | 10 積分
 
	                電子發(fā)燒友App
	            
	        
	        
          
        
        
	                    
                        
                        
                        
                        
                        


創(chuàng)作
發(fā)文章
發(fā)帖  
提問  
發(fā)資料
發(fā)視頻
上傳資料賺積分
           
            
            
                
            
評論